Understanding Your Citroen Berlingo Key System


The Citroen Berlingo has evolved substantially over its production history, and with each iteration, the essential innovation has actually advanced accordingly. Comprehending which type of essential your automobile utilizes kinds the structure of the replacement process, as various systems need various approaches and equipment.

Modern Berlingo vans normally use one of 3 key systems. The most fundamental configuration uses a conventional mechanical secret with no electronic components, discovered mostly in older pre-2005 designs. These keys run purely mechanically and can frequently be duplicated at any regional locksmith or hardware store without unique programs equipment. Nevertheless, as vehicle security advanced, makers introduced keys with integrated transponder chips that interact with the car's immobiliser system. These transponder keys require programs to match the specific van's security code, ensuring only authorised keys can start the engine.

The third and most sophisticated configuration incorporates remote central locking functionality along with the transponder chip. citroen car key replacement cost enable owners to lock and unlock the van from another location and frequently consist of additional features such as panic buttons or tailgate release functions. The most recent Berlingo designs utilise distance keys, frequently called “hands-free” keys, which allow keyless entry and push-button start functionality. These advanced systems contain advanced electronic devices and need dealer-level devices for proper replacement and programs.

Exploring Replacement Options


Citroen Berlingo van owners normally have three main pathways for getting replacement keys, each offering distinct benefits and drawbacks regarding expense, benefit, and service quality.

Authorised Citroen Dealerships

Selecting an authorised dealership makes sure O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ts and licensed programming carried out by Technicians trained particularly on Citroen automobiles. Dealers possess the current diagnostic devices and direct access to the producer's essential code database, removing potential issues with programming treatments. However, this qualified service comes at a premium rate, and owners must expect greater labour rates and parts expenses compared to alternative choices. Additionally, car dealership visits may need waiting numerous days, particularly if the specific essential code needs to be retrieved from the maker's database.

Professional Automotive Locksmiths

Specialised vehicle locksmiths offer an engaging middle ground, supplying crucial replacement services at normally lower expenses than dealerships while maintaining professional programs capabilities. Lots of automotive locksmith professionals now buy the exact same sophisticated programs equipment used by dealers, allowing them to deal with even distance essential replacements for Berlingo vans. The benefit aspect typically favours locksmith professionals, as many offer mobile services that take a trip straight to the car's area. This mobile capability shows particularly important for commercial automobile owners who can not pay for extended downtime.

Do it yourself Replacement

For owners of older Berlingo models with easy mechanical keys, purchasing a blank key and having it cut at a hardware store uses the most economical option. However, this approach just uses to basic keys without transponder chips or remote performance. Attempting to change modern electronic keys without correct programming equipment will lead to a non-functional secret, making this choice viable just for particular older car applications.

The Replacement Process Explained


Understanding what occurs during a key replacement consultation assists owners understand what to expect and prepare suitable documentation. Regardless of the service provider chosen, the procedure generally follows a constant pattern.

The service provider initially confirms car ownership by requesting documentation such as the vehicle registration file (V5C), proof of insurance coverage, and individual identification. This verification action secures owners from unauthorised people acquiring keys to vehicles they do not own. The supplier then accesses the automobile's recognition number (VIN) to recover the proper key code from the maker's database. For contemporary automobiles with proximity systems, this action makes sure the new key is appropriately coupled with the vehicle's security system.

When the proper key blank is acquired, the cutting process produces the physical blade that fits the ignition and door locks. For electronic keys, programming follows cutting, establishing communication between the key's transponder chip and the vehicle's immobiliser system. This shows procedure normally takes between half an hour and two hours depending upon the crucial complexity and vehicle system. After programs, the specialist evaluates all functions consisting of unlocking, locking, and engine beginning to verify correct operation.

Regularly Asked Questions


How long does Citroen Berlingo essential replacement usually take?

The duration depends substantially on the essential type and service company. Basic mechanical crucial cutting at a hardware shop takes just minutes. Transponder crucial replacement at a dealer or locksmith usually needs one to two hours for shows. Distance crucial replacements for newer designs might require ordering the essential blank first, potentially extending the procedure to a number of days if the part need to be sourced from the provider.

Do I need to supply any paperwork for essential replacement?

Legitimate company require proof of automobile ownership for security functions. Owners ought to provide the automobile registration file (V5C), a kind of individual identification such as a driving licence, and proof of insurance coverage covering the lorry. These files verify that the individual requesting the secret has legal authority to have one.

Can any automobile locksmith professional replace a Berlingo van key?

Not all locksmiths have the specialised equipment required for modern-day car crucial shows. Owners ought to verify that the locksmith has experience with French automobiles particularly and keeps current programs devices for Berlingo designs. Numerous automobile locksmiths promote their ability for dealer-level programs, and inspecting reviews or requesting demonstrations of their devices capability supplies additional self-confidence.
